Timeless Blooms That Never Fade
While trends come and go, some flowers remain favorites year after year. Roses, peonies, and lilies are classic choices that exude romance and elegance. These timeless blooms speak to the heart and are perfect for any wedding theme. Their enduring popularity is a testament to their beauty and versatility.
Roses are often associated with love and passion, making them a perfect choice for weddings. Peonies, with their lush, full blooms, add a touch of sophistication. Lilies bring a sense of purity and grace. By incorporating these flowers into your arrangements, you ensure that your wedding day photos remain timeless.

Tips for Choosing Seasonal Flowers
Choosing flowers in season not only ensures freshness but also keeps costs down. Spring weddings offer an abundance of options like tulips and daffodils, which symbolize new beginnings. Summer brings sunflowers and hydrangeas, adding warmth and vibrancy.
When planning a fall wedding, consider rich hues with chrysanthemums and dahlias. These flowers complement the season's palette and add warmth to your decor. Winter weddings can embrace the elegance of amaryllis and evergreens, perfect for a cozy, festive feel.
By aligning your flower choices with the season, you enhance the natural beauty of your wedding day. For more insights, this blog offers expert advice on seasonal selections.
Flower Arrangement Tips for Every Season
Seasonal considerations go beyond flower types; they also influence arrangement styles. In spring, opt for airy and light arrangements that reflect the season's freshness. Use cascading greens in summer to mimic lush gardens, creating a natural and inviting atmosphere.
Autumn arrangements can incorporate dried elements alongside fresh flowers, adding texture and depth. For winter, focus on rich, deep colors and incorporate elements like berries or pinecones to evoke a cozy, intimate setting.
These seasonal arrangement tips ensure that your floral decor resonates with the time of year, enhancing the overall theme of your wedding.
